Fee Structure And Facilities

As the college is affiliated with delhi university a government university the fee structure is very feasible and nominal the fees for the BA Programme course is just 5695 only and the fees of other courses is also nearly same.

Hostel Facilities

4

Our college do not have hostel facilities but one can find private paying guests near the college at reasonable rates in good localities at around 10000 to 13000 a month with food and a room sharing of the canteen food is hygenic and of good quality.

Exam Structure

The exam structure is really good as it doesnnot overburdens the students as only 4 exams are being held in 1 semester and there 2 semesters per year.
